Ubuntu下Apache2+PHP5+MySQL5的成功安装

zjx0 2008-01-19

在Ubuntu7.10下安装配置WWW服务器是一件很简单的事情,比在WINDOWS下配置IIS容易的多了!

贴下安装过程,虽然我大多用新立得来自动安装的。

一、安装Apache2
sudo apt-get install apache2
然后在Firefox中打开:
http://localhost/
提示成功

二、安装PHP5
sudo apt-get install php5
sudo apt-get install libapache2-mod-php5
sudo /etc/init.d/apache2 restart

测试PHP5是否安装成功
sudo gedit /var/www/testphp.php
在里面写入
<?php
phpinfo();
?>

然后在Firefox中打开:
http://localhost/testphp.php

看完后把testphp.php删掉,可能会有安全风险〔我用了sudo rm的命令行,因为普通似乎不能删除== 正确方法不了解= = by 某s〕

三、安装MySql
sudo apt-get install mysql-server

MySql初始只允许本机(127.0.0.1)连接,如果想多台机子使用或者向Internet开放的话,编辑/etc/mysql/my.cnf
sudo gedit /etc/mysql/my.cnf
找到
bind-address = 127.0.0.1〔没准备让它外接所以没搞这个〕
用#注释掉,象这样
#bind-address = 127.0.0.1

MySql默认没有设置root密码,本机的root用户也没有密码,有风险是吧,这样
mysqladmin -u root password your-new-password
mysqladmin -h root@local-machine-name -u root -p password your-new-password
sudo /etc/init.d/mysql restart〔没有搞,我就默认了root进去= =〕

安装MYSQL Administrator
sudo apt-get install mysql-admin
安装好后在Gnome-应用程序-系统工具-MySQL Administrator〔使用浏览器的管理界面,好爱!by 某s〕

安装MYSQL for Apache HTTP Server
sudo apt-get install libapache2-mod-auth-mysql
sudo apt-get install php5-mysql
sudo apt-get install phpmyadmin

要让PHP与MySql一起工作,编辑
sudo gedit /etc/php5/apache2/php.ini
取消对;extension=mysql.so的注释,象这样

extension=mysql.so
… [<=某s完全没有发现这个一条阿!所以忽略了〕

保存文件,然后
sudo /etc/init.d/apache2 restart

测试:
http://localhost/phpmyadmin〔反正出来了就好了吧?〕

相关推荐